Mila Frohlicstein Hopes to Make"Change" in her Community

The Galvin Middle School student who organized a coin drive to support the food pantry, earns distinction as this week's Wakefield Whiz Kid.

Each week, Wakefield Patch will select a Whiz Kid of the Week.

 This week, we chose Mila Frohlichstein, a student who organized her own coin drive to support her local food pantry. 

 Wakefield Patch's Whiz Kid of the Week for Feb. 16:

  • Name: Mila Frohlichstein
  • Age: 10
  • School: 4th grade, Dolbeare School in Wakefield, MA.

 Why she's a Whiz Kid:

 After seeing a friend from another school conduct a coin fundraiser, Mila was inspired to do the same at her elementary school, the Dolbeare School.  Mila partnered with Gathering Change, Inc., a non-profit charitable organization that collects spare change from our communities for distribution back into the neighborhood food pantries and social programs.

 Working with her school, Mila placed coin collection jars in all four of the fourth grade classrooms and one in the main office last spring.  Through her hard work and dedication, Mila was able to raise over $143 in spare change.  She sent that money to Gathering Change, Inc., who promptly donated the money to the .
